Miami Holiday Project continues to spread cheer to area children

Help brighten the holidays for local children by donating to the Miami Holiday Project, an annual service event spearheaded by Miami University's Classified Personnel Advisory Committee.

The Miami Holiday Project is a local service project that accepts donations for children in foster care within Butler and Preble counties.  All of the children are under county court supervision, many due to abuse, neglect or abandonment. 

With the money raised, organizers and volunteers will shop for the children and provide them with something special on their wish list.  The money goes toward clothing, toys and other items for the children.
